dgdee, the power steering cooler is mounted above the front axle on the passenger side. Its above the airdam but is pointed at a downward angle and looks like it might catch debris from the road. I live on a farm and I know if I drove one down a picked corn field and kept the tires in the furrow, the row of stalks would line up with the cooler and beat it up good. Maybe it won't cause any problems where it's at, but it doesn't look like a good place to me.
